如何判断js变量是否为空如何判断js变量是否为空
1、为了向下兼容,exp 为 null 时,typeof null 总返回 object,所以不能这样判断。
2、首先,打开html编辑器,新建html文件,例如:index.html。在index.html中的标签,输入js代码:if ($(input).val() !== ) {$(body).append(非空);}。
3、if (typeof(str)== undefined){ alert(undefined);} if(str==null){ alert(null);} if(str==“”){ alert(空);} 目前,null和undefined基本是同义的,只有一些细微的差别。
4、正规写法:if(id2 === undefined){ //id2没有传参数 注意是3个等号。} 这是jQuery中源码的写法。
js判断对象是否为空
大多数都是通过直接比较的,类似于:if(对象 == null)这是高级语言比较的方式,如果js的话,需要使用typeof的方式比较undefined的形式进行判断是否为空。
在AngularJs中判断对象是否为空,可以使用angular.equals,如下:AngularJS AngularJS诞生于2009年,由Misko Hevery 等人创建,后为Google所收购。是一款优秀的前端JS框架,已经被用于Google的多款产品当中。
if(jStr=={}){ document.write(1121);} var j = {key:value};if(j.key){ document.write(1122);} 去json官网下一个jsonjs 文件。引入,里面有一些json的操作。用stringify 就可以判断。
例如,可以表示数组和复杂的对象,而不仅仅是键和值的简单列表。
window是javascript的顶层对象,所有的全局变量都是它的属性。所以,判断myobj是否为空,等同于判断window对象是否有myobj属性,这样就可以避免因为myObj没有定义而出现ReferenceError错误。
js怎么判断是否为空js怎么判断是否为空对象
1、js判断一个对象是否是空对象的几种方法 1。
2、大多数都是通过直接比较的,类似于:if(对象 == null)这是高级语言比较的方式,如果js的话,需要使用typeof的方式比较undefined的形式进行判断是否为空。
3、判断数组是否为空,可以用length方法,如:var a = [];if(a.length ==0){ alert(1)}else{ alert(2)} 判断数组为空不能用if(a),因为a这个时候是一个空数组对象,if会判断当前a是对象,返回true。
4、在AngularJs中判断对象是否为空,可以使用angular.equals,如下:AngularJS AngularJS诞生于2009年,由Misko Hevery 等人创建,后为Google所收购。是一款优秀的前端JS框架,已经被用于Google的多款产品当中。
js判断获取的值是否为空的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js获取是否checked、js判断获取的值是否为空的信息别忘了在本站进行查找喔。